The Role
As a Technical Conveyancing Auditor, you will be at the forefront of maintaining technical excellence and file quality across the branch network. You will conduct detailed audits of conveyancing files, provide feedback to fee earners, monitor risk exposure, and support ongoing staff development and operational improvement.
Key responsibilities include:
- Performing systematic audits of residential conveyancing files
- Identifying risks, compliance issues, and procedural inconsistencies
- Offering practical, solution-focused feedback to fee earners
- Supporting the professional development of conveyancers through mentoring and guidance
- Helping drive consistency in technical standards across the group
- Keeping teams updated on legislative changes and regulatory updates
- Collaborating with senior leadership to refine compliance and quality frameworks
- Feeding into internal training, supervision, and policy development
Candidate Profile
We\’re looking for a technically strong conveyancing professional who is passionate about quality, compliance, and continuous improvement.
Essential:
- Background as a residential conveyancer – solicitor, legal executive or licensed conveyancer
- Strong understanding of conveyancing processes from instruction to completion
- Excellent working knowledge of CQS, SRA regulations, and general risk/compliance requirements
- High attention to detail and confident in auditing and report writing
- Ability to communicate clearly and constructively with conveyancing teams
- Technically minded with a proactive, problem-solving attitude
Desirable:
- Previous experience in auditing, training, compliance or quality assurance
- Familiarity with case management systems and digital audit tools
- Experience working in a multi-office or volume conveyancing environment
